About Melbourne CBD

Celebrated as Australia’s capital of cool, Melbourne is brimming with world-class restaurants, quirky boutiques and trendy bars. The CBD is the beating heart of the city, with the Yarra River flowing through its centre. Beyond its quirky hipster residents, Melbourne serves up a string of cultural attractions. So jump aboard one of Melbourne’s iconic trams and start exploring.

Things to Do

Melbourne is a shopper’s paradise with most of the action centred around Bourke Street Mall. Find funky boutiques in Melbourne’s revitalised laneways and high-end retail outlets in the heritage-listed Block Arcade. For bargains, head to the DFO South Wharf outlet.

Federation Square is great for people watching, with the magnificent Flinders Street Railway Station and St Paul’s Cathedral just across the tram tracks. For art aficionados, the National Gallery of Victoria showcases a fantastic collection of Australian and indigenous art.

Beyond the city’s vibrant culture, Melbourne is known as Australia’s sports capital. Catch a footy match at the MCG, cheer Melbourne’s rugby and soccer teams at AAMI Park and visit the National Sports Museum. If you love tennis, a tour of Melbourne Park is a must.

Melbourne is also a mecca for foodies, with Queen Victoria Market just a short walk from the CBD. Snag a table at one of Chinatown’s legendary dumpling restaurants, snack on tapas at a laneway eatery, or hit up one of the gastro bars along the waterfront.

Getting Around

Melbourne makes things easy with a citywide tram network, plus free travel within the CBD. Simply buy a myki card and jump aboard. Trains and buses also run in the CBD, as well as outer suburbs. There are plenty of taxis to hail, or you can join the locals and embrace Uber. If you’re travelling to the airport, the SkyBus runs directly from Flinders Street Station.

  • How do you get to Melbourne CBD from the city centre?

    Luckily, tourists staying in Melbourne CBD already find themselves in the centre of the city. A good way to travel around the centre of the city is by tram; there’s even a free City Circle tram especially for tourists. This service operates Thursday to Saturday 10:00 to 21:00 and Sunday to Wednesday 10:00 to 18:00. Other tram services operate from 05:00 to midnight Monday to Thursday, 24 hours a day on Friday and Saturday and 07:00 to 23:00 on Sunday. You can also board the buses with the same tickets used for trams. There are two bus zones, and the price depends on the distance travelled. Most buses operate between 05:00 and midnight, and night buses are available on Saturday and Sunday. Passengers travelling from the airport will find the easier method into the city to be by SkyBus. There’s also car hire and taxis available.
